MUMBAI, India, May 30 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202517044407 A) filed by Robert Bosch Gmbh, Stuttgart, Germany, on May 7, for 'cooling structure of a cooler through which fluid can flow.'

Inventor(s) include Beck, Max Florian; Ruedenauer, Valentin; Hoppe, Tobias; and Stehlik, Daniel.

The application for the patent was published on May 30, under issue no. 22/2025.

According to the abstract released by the Intellectual Property India: "The present invention relates to a cooling structure (1) of a cooler (100) through which fluid can flow, the cooling structure being formed from a U-profile (10) which repeats periodically in a repetition direction (501) and which comprises wavy limbs (15) extending in a longitudinal direction (502) of the cooling structure (1) and formed according to a trigonometric function (13)."

The patent application was internationally filed on Oct. 24, 2023, under International application No.PCT/EP2023/079578.
